Description
I love the physical impact of Slaf's game and how he helps Suzuki attack the middle in a way Caufield rarely does. I know everyone thinks about Dach as a Center, but I would love to see what he can do as a winger on a line with Zuke & Slaf.

If you'll recall Dach & Slaf had some major chemistry through the preseason and right up until Dach got injured. A top line of Suzuki centering Slaf on the left and Dach on the right feels like it could explode. I imagine Dach's ability to protect the puck along the boards with his huge wingspan (one of his best skills in my opinion) jiving perfectly with how Slaf & Zuke have been connecting the past 30 games. Caufield is probably, unfortunately, the odd man out, mostly because he does not attack the middle of the ice.

I would look at moving Caufield to a second line position, on more of a finesse line, and with lower competition he will be able to rack up more points. Obviously he and Zegras are best buds and I would tap into that the same way the Avs are taping into Drouin's connection with MacKinnon.

I would go get Zegras in the offseason and pickup a RW to play with them. It's time for this team to have 2 true scoring lines.

I chose Tarasenko because he plays with a bit of a physical edge and he seems willing to sign a shorter term deal. Maybe he'll like the idea of playing on that line?

Additional Details:
There is no package that makes sense for BOTH teams and makes BOTH teams better next year. If Anaheim is not sold on Zegras, and is willing to take futures for him, this is the sort of package that could help them be a force in a few years.

Anaheim doesn't want any of the Habs LD prospects. The Habs do not have any forwards they are willing to trade that are better than anything Anaheim has in their pipeline. The truth is the only way this deal gets done is if Anaheim wants Zegras gone.

I think this is a compelling package in that case, and for fans who say this is too much, I will remind you that Zegras has more points in his 20 year old season than Suzuki & Caufield combined.
